What HUD offices serve Littleton, Colorado?

Public Housing Agencies operate federally assisted affordable housing programs atlocal levels on behalf of HUD. Notably, housing agencies are responsible for managing Section 8Housing Choice Voucher, Public Housing, and Project-Based Voucher waiting lists within theirjurisdiction.

South Metro Housing Options

Operates the Section 8 Housing Choice Voucher (HCV), Public Housing programs for Littleton, Colorado.

Housing Authority of the City of Aurora

Operates the Section 8 Housing Choice Voucher (HCV), Public Housing, Veteran Affairs Supportive Housing (VASH), Section 8 Project-Based Voucher (PBV), Section 8 Project-Based Rental Assistance (PBRA), Family Unification Program (FUP) programs for Littleton, Colorado.

How many renters live in Littleton, Colorado?

The City of Littleton has 45,531people living in 20,484 households.

There are 15,067 renters living in8,156 renter households in thisCity. Renters make up 33.09percent of the population living in Littleton.

What is the rental market like in Littleton, Colorado?

There are an estimated 21,618 housing units in theLittleton area. Of these, 8,807 units are rentalhomes, making up 41 percent of the housing market. Forevery renter household in Littleton, Colorado, there are1 rental units.

What is the vacancy rate for rentals in Littleton?

The rental vacancy rate in Littleton is 7 percent.This is ahigher than averagevacancy rate.When rental vacancy rates are high it means that there are a lot of available units and rents tendto be lower.

How many renter households in Littleton are overburdened by housing costs?

Among renter households in this market, 53percent havehousing cost burden. Further, 27percent of households are extremely rent overburdened. When renters pay too much for their housing, itleaveslittle money for other necessities like food, clothes, or medicine.

The federal government says that renters arecost-burdened if they pay more than a third of their monthly income for rent and utilities.

How Much Is Rent in Littleton

Depending on size, the Fair Market Rent - HUDs measurement of the cost of an average housing unit - rangesfrom $1,658 to $3,225. FMRs areupdated annually by HUD for every city and county nationwide.

Bed Size2024 Fair Market Rents
Studio$1,658
One BR$1,835
Two BR$2,201
Three BR$2,874
Four BR$3,225

How many units are rented at Fair Market Rent (FMR) in Littleton?

Renters with a Section 8 Housing Choice Voucher must select a home that is at or below the area’s FairMarket Rent. Markets with a large share of units above FMR tend to have longer search times to find aqualified unit, while those with a large share of units below FMR tend to have more choices and shortersearch times. The share below FMR can vary by size of unit, as shown in the table below.

These are the approximate number of units renting below the FMR in this market:

Unit SizeCount of Units Below FMRPercentage of Total Units Below FMR
Studio36172 percent
One BR2,08359 percent
Two BR1,09237 percent

Income Based Apartments in Littleton, Colorado

Littleton features 484 income based apartments.Tenants of income based apartments typically pay no more than 30% of their income towards rent andutilities.

Low Rent Apartments in Littleton, Colorado

There are 386 rent subsidized apartments that do notprovide direct rental assistance but remain affordable to low income households in Littleton.

Housing Choice Vouchers in Littleton, Colorado

On average, Section 8 Housing Choice vouchers pay Littleton landlords$1,100 per month towards rent. The average voucher holdercontributes $400 towards rent inLittleton.

The maximum amount a voucher would pay on behalf of a low-income tenant in Littleton, Colorado fora two-bedroom apartment is between $1,981 and $2,421.
